pub enum Tsif {
    Value1 = 0,
    Value2 = 1,
}
Expand description

Transmit Shift Indication Flag

Value on reset: 0

Variants§

§

Value1 = 0

0: A transmit shift event has not occurred.

§

Value2 = 1

1: A transmit shift event has occurred.
